Bell 47G2 N6701D
8 March 1980 · Brentwood, California, United States · Serious injuries
Summary
On 8 March 1980 at about 11:10 local time, a Bell 47G2 registered N6701D, operated by Agri-Copters, was involved in an accident during in flight near Brentwood, California, United States. One person was on board and one was seriously injured. The aircraft was destroyed. No probable cause statement is available for this record.

Read the full NTSB narrative
TAIL ROTOR BLADE YOKE, PN.47-641-057-9, SN 29-10598, FAILED.
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record.
